usually its the frequency that is not set correctly (its still set to the old monitor's)
2 ways:
1. start bf2/pr with no parameters, go to options and set to a resolution using 60hz
or
2. manually change your the frequency in Video.con: VideoSettings.setResolution 800x600@60Hz

i am thinking you might have changed the wrong file...
you have to change the "video.con" in your current accounts folder. that is in the "profiles"-folder a folder like "0001" there you will find some more ".con" files also the "video.con"
your short cut looks ok, you do not need widescreen fixer when running in 800x600 (which should only be a temporary resolution to get this problem fixed)
widescreen fixer has to be activated by pressing ";" - you can start it when ever you want there is no particular order
if you do not mind resetting your keys you can also just delete the contents of the profiles folder (but please back it up just to make sure). bf2 should create new default files and you will have to "retrieve" your old account
please also try starting normal bf2 and see if it works

RELAX! I have fixed it.
I tried to run it in windows mode and it told me that there was a file on the CD that was allocated to 75hz. Hmmm I thought. So I refitted my OLD monitor, ran the game, set the resolution to 800 X 600 and 60 hz. Put the new monitor back on and put it in 800 X 600 then loaded the game. Reset the resolution to the highest and now it works.
